Touring cycling around Llanegryn offers routes through varied landscapes, characterized by coastal roads, estuary paths, and rolling countryside. The region features a mix of flat sections ideal for relaxed rides and more challenging ascents with notable elevation gains. Riders can expect to encounter scenic views of the Mawddach and Dyfi Estuaries, as well as inland areas with lakes and rural settings.

For the circular route around Allt-lwyd there are some boulder like sections very difficult on a gravel bike on the north side climb. I’d recommend using the other south side of the hill for the climb (tarmac to top) and at least the worst sections can be done downhill. You’ll still have one tricky uphill bit though. Can get wet w/ deep puddles after extended rain.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the overall difficulty range for touring cycling routes in Llanegryn?

Llanegryn offers a diverse range of touring cycling routes. Out of 57 available tours, you'll find 10 easy routes, 25 moderate routes, and 22 difficult routes, catering to various skill levels from beginners to experienced cyclists.

Are there any family-friendly touring cycling routes in Llanegryn?

Yes, Llanegryn has several routes suitable for families. While specific 'family-friendly' designations aren't always explicit, routes with lower elevation gain and shorter distances, often found among the 10 easy tours, are generally more appropriate. Consider exploring paths along the estuaries for flatter sections.

What are the typical distances of touring cycling routes around Llanegryn?

The touring cycling routes in Llanegryn vary significantly in length. You can find shorter rides, such as the Rose's Open Shop – Deja Vu Cafe loop from Tywyn at 15.8 miles (25.5 km), or longer, more challenging tours like the Mawddach Estuary Trail – Penmaenpool Toll Bridge loop from Tonfanau, which spans 34.5 miles (55.6 km).

What kind of scenery can I expect on touring cycling routes in Llanegryn?

Touring cycling around Llanegryn is characterized by stunning estuary views, particularly along the Mawddach and Dyfi Estuaries, coastal roads, and serene countryside paths. You'll encounter a mix of landscapes, from flat sections ideal for relaxed rides to more challenging ascents with expansive vistas.

Are there any circular touring cycling routes available?

Yes, many touring cycling routes in Llanegryn are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ish in the same location. Examples include the popular Dyfi Estuary Coast Road – Aberdyfi Beach loop from Tywyn and the Rose's Open Shop loop from Llanegryn.

What do other touring cyclists say about the routes in Llanegryn?

The touring cycling routes in Llanegryn are highly regarded by the komoot community, boasting an average rating of 4.6 stars from over 100 reviews. More than 1000 touring cyclists have used komoot to explore the varied terrain, often praising the scenic estuary views and diverse landscapes.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ions I might see while cycling?

While cycling around Llanegryn, you can encounter several interesting landmarks and natural attractions. The Mawddach Estuary Trail itself is a highlight, offering beautiful views. You might also spot the Barmouth Bridge or enjoy views of Llyn Cau, a stunning lake in the Cadair Idris range.

Are there any routes that pass by lakes or significant natural features?

Yes, some routes venture inland towards natural features. For instance, the Dôl Idris Lake – Corris loop from Tywyn will take you past Dôl Idris Lake. The region also features the scenic Cregennan Lakes, which are popular for their tranquil setting.

When is the best time of year to go touring cycling in Llanegryn?

The best time for touring cycling in Llanegryn is generally from spring through early autumn (April to October). During these months, the weather is typically milder and drier, and the days are longer, offering more comfortable riding conditions and better visibility for enjoying the scenic views.

What should I consider regarding weather conditions for cycling in Llanegryn?

Llanegryn, being in a coastal and mountainous region of Wales, can experience changeable weather. Be prepared for rain at any time of year, and winds can be a factor, especially along the estuaries and coast. Always check the local forecast before heading out and dress in layers.

Are there routes suitable for advanced touring cyclists looking for a challenge?

Absolutely. Llanegryn offers 22 difficult routes with substantial climbs and significant elevation gains. The Mawddach Estuary Trail – Penmaenpool Toll Bridge loop from Tonfanau, for example, features over 730 meters of elevation gain, providing a robust challenge for experienced riders.
